Understanding Rising Damp & Moisture Problems in Madurai Climate


Madurai experiences a tropical climate with intense monsoon rains from October to January and persistent humidity throughout the year. These conditions create an ideal environment for rising damp and moisture problems in buildings. Rising damp occurs when groundwater moves upward through porous building materials like bricks and mortar, carrying salts that damage walls and floors.


Moisture problems are not limited to rising damp. Water seepage through cracks, condensation due to humidity, and poor drainage can all contribute to damp walls and structural decay. If left untreated, these issues can lead to peeling paint, mold growth, and even weakening of the foundation.


Key factors contributing to dampness in Madurai:


  • Heavy monsoon rainfall saturating the soil around foundations

  • High relative humidity causing condensation inside buildings

  • Heat stress causing expansion and contraction of building materials, leading to cracks

  • Inadequate or damaged waterproofing layers in older constructions


Understanding these factors is the first step in preventing costly damage and maintaining a healthy indoor environment.


How Water Damage Affects Property Value & Structural Integrity


Water damage is more than just an aesthetic problem. It directly impacts the structural integrity of your property and its market value. Persistent dampness weakens concrete, bricks, and wood, leading to cracks, spalling, and even structural failure over time.


From a financial perspective, properties with visible damp issues often face reduced resale value. Potential buyers are wary of hidden damages and the expensive repairs that may follow. Moreover, water damage can cause health hazards such as mold and mildew, which affect indoor air quality and occupant well-being.


Common consequences of untreated water damage include:


  • Cracked and crumbling walls and plaster

  • Rusting of steel reinforcements within concrete

  • Warping and rotting of wooden elements

  • Increased energy costs due to poor insulation from damp walls

  • Health risks from mold spores and allergens

Professional Waterproofing Methods: Liquid Coatings, Membranes & More


Effective waterproofing requires a combination of modern materials and expert application techniques. As a leading waterproofing contractor in Madurai, I recommend the following proven methods tailored to local conditions:


1. Liquid Waterproofing Coatings


These are applied as a liquid membrane that cures to form a seamless, flexible barrier against water ingress. Liquid coatings are ideal for roofs, terraces, and walls. They adapt well to surface irregularities and provide excellent resistance to UV rays and temperature fluctuations.


2. Bituminous Membranes


Bituminous membranes are thick, durable sheets applied to foundations and basements. They offer robust protection against rising damp and groundwater seepage. These membranes are often combined with protective screeds or insulation layers for enhanced performance.


3. Cementitious Waterproofing


This method uses cement-based products mixed with waterproofing additives. It is commonly used for internal wet areas like bathrooms and water tanks. Cementitious waterproofing is easy to apply and bonds well with concrete surfaces.


4. Injection Grouting for Rising Damp


For existing walls affected by rising damp, chemical injection grouting is an effective solution. It involves injecting water-repellent chemicals into the wall base to create a barrier that stops moisture from rising.


5. External Drainage and Landscaping


Proper site drainage is crucial to prevent water accumulation near foundations. Installing French drains, grading the landscape away from the building, and maintaining gutters and downspouts help reduce moisture exposure.

Identifying Damp Walls & Water Seepage Early (Symptom Recognition)


Early detection of dampness can save you from expensive repairs and structural damage. Here are common signs to watch for:


  • Discoloured patches or stains on walls and ceilings

  • Peeling or bubbling paint and wallpaper

  • Musty or moldy odours inside rooms

  • Efflorescence - white, powdery salt deposits on walls

  • Damp or cold spots on walls, especially near the floor

  • Cracks in plaster or masonry

  • Rust stains on metal fixtures or reinforcements


Regularly inspect vulnerable areas such as basements, bathrooms, kitchens, and external walls facing prevailing winds and rain. Using a moisture meter can provide precise readings to confirm dampness levels.


If you notice any of these symptoms, it is crucial to act promptly. Delaying treatment allows moisture to penetrate deeper, increasing repair complexity and costs.


Waterproofing Solutions for Different Building Types in Madurai


Madurai’s diverse building stock includes residential homes, commercial complexes, and industrial facilities. Each type requires tailored waterproofing strategies:


Residential Properties


Homes often suffer from rising damp in basements and ground floors, as well as roof leaks during monsoon. Liquid coatings on terraces, injection grouting for walls, and proper gutter maintenance are essential. Interior damp wall solutions like cementitious waterproofing in bathrooms prevent moisture buildup.


Commercial Buildings


Commercial structures face higher foot traffic and more complex drainage needs. Bituminous membranes combined with external drainage systems protect foundations. Regular maintenance of HVAC systems helps control indoor humidity.


Industrial Facilities


Industrial buildings may have large flat roofs and heavy machinery generating heat and moisture. Multi-layer waterproofing systems with membranes and protective screeds ensure durability. Moisture control is critical to prevent corrosion of equipment and structural steel.

Long-Term Protection: Maintenance & Inspection Guidelines


Waterproofing is not a one-time fix but a long-term commitment. Regular maintenance and inspections extend the life of your waterproofing system and prevent recurrence of dampness.


Recommended maintenance practices include:


  • Annual inspection of roofs, terraces, and external walls for cracks or damage

  • Cleaning and clearing gutters, downspouts, and drainage channels before monsoon

  • Reapplying liquid coatings or sealants every 3-5 years as per manufacturer guidelines

  • Monitoring indoor humidity levels and using dehumidifiers if necessary

  • Promptly repairing any leaks or cracks detected during inspections


Documenting maintenance activities and moisture assessments helps track the condition of your property and plan timely interventions.
